Transaction 64aacdaacff699dae1f56e81930ec79e37c9c96f72c9877e65c36646a6a9c860
1 Input
1 Output
-
64aacdaacff699dae1f56e81930ec79e37c9c96f72c9877e65c36646a6a9c860:0
- value
- 1750849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53bb6b8aeacdf9a581c0d02254ff18069c974110 OP_EQUAL
- address
- 39KkXeAzhPdVisjzWTaT7Cj8fkaForNbxF